Output 4da623ec7aa6315cd1e5ed9fd256a9f53441b16ae04e87d2b96986e244f6d5fe:7

value
2824735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5811efe789c1e56924aa55cb54965672c1931e OP_EQUAL
address
3JgK7STXfbJC2Nzp68d6pLsrejadW1uWa7
transaction
4da623ec7aa6315cd1e5ed9fd256a9f53441b16ae04e87d2b96986e244f6d5fe
spent
true